Output 8505212514ef32acb6ff38977a17851c3c37ce697c953c91115873bf0e6de768:5

value
176786
script pubkey
OP_0 OP_PUSHBYTES_20 97199158fab3250f0466b890e14501bfa400753a
address
bc1qjuvezk86kvjs7prxhzgwz3gph7jqqaf68y2q0l
transaction
8505212514ef32acb6ff38977a17851c3c37ce697c953c91115873bf0e6de768
spent
true